Default Upgrade from Sangean ATS 505 to Eton E5: Worth it?

KJ,

IMO, the E5 is worthy step up from the 505. I've owned them both. The
505 was so-so. Gave it to a friend in Kansas. The E5 might be the most
sensitve compact SW portable I've ever owned. And, I've noticed that
they're going for some pretty reasonable prices on eBay.
